BRIEF BIOGRAPHY ABOUT RUTH ABIODUN AGUDA.

 Ruth Abiodun Aguda was born on December 19, 1954 at the Apostolic Church Faith Home in Yaba, Lagos. To late Pastor & Deaconess Elijah Olude. She was raised at 35 Ondo Street, Ebute Metta.
She attended the The Apostolic Church Primary School, Ebute Metta, from 1961 to1968, before proceeding to Cherubim and Seraphim Secondary School Ilorin where she spent only 2years before transferring to St Clare's Girl School, Offa; where she graduated in 1974.
She enrolled and studied for the Teachers Grade Two A, Pivotal at Women's Teachers College, Kabba and graduated in June 1975. Ruth was joined in holy matrimony with Michael Olorunmaiye Aguda, (who have courted her for 8years ) at  The Apostolic Church, Orokere- Amuro on Dec 20, 1975. Her first teaching job was with Command children school , Kaduna, from Sept 1975 to Dec 1979.
She briefly taught at Mopa, Domestic  School from Jan- June 1980, before traveling to USA with her two sons then, Moses and Solomon to join her husband. Their only girl arrived in 1981, thus she could not enroll in College until Jan 1982.
She studied at then, Highland Park Community College, before proceeding to University of Detroit to earn her bachelor's degree in Education in 1985. She returned home ( Nigeria) with her husband and Children then, Moses, Solomon,now late, and Deborah in Sept 1985 with 5 months pregnancy of her fourth child.  Daniel her last son arrived in 1986 on Valentine's day at Minna, Niger State.
She completed her mandatory NYC in 1987; and moved to Lagos with her family in 1988, because of a new   seconment posting  of her husband to Foriegn Service, Overseas Communications Department as Chief Engineer. 
She established Quality Day Care in their Official Quarters at OCD, Aiyetoro, Ijanikin in 1991 which later moved to a new location and developed to a full Lagos State Approved Primary school. Auntie Maiyedun Primary School, was a popular school in the neighborhood because of the American flavor to handling the kids.
She was Proprietress and Head Teacher of this school until year 2007 when she moved back to USA with her husband after retiring from NITEL. Ruth taught for about 10years at Zion Christian Church nursery school until when the school was closed due to Covid. 
She was ill for about two years and hospitalized at St John Ascension hospital in Warren, Michigan for about a month before the Lord called her to Glory, on early morning of April 19, 2021.
She left behind a loving husband, children, grandchildren and siblings. Until her demise, Ruth was a committed Deaconess in The Apostolic Church, and a member of the Auxiliary of Gideons International, Detroit North Woodward Camp.She's very much missed by her Church, home and abroad, co-workers, friends, relatives and family.
